This may be a little late, but it seems that Globalia no longer run this route. I've not seen a globalia bus for months and the website & app no longer work. 

It seems they have been replaced by BamBus, who offer a much more restricted service - only 3 buses each way per day in summer (2 on Sundays), and only 2 each way per day from 1 October (1 on Sundays). 

Their schedule can be found on this website: https://www.busbam.com/horarios/cartagena-alicante/

Hopefully they will increase services after the covid19 mess has cleared and flight numbers increase again.

Just to mention I caught the BAM Bus from alicante Airport last week. Pay on the bus 7.95  one way to Santiago de la ribera.. bus stop 21 ( Cartagena) on ground floor at airport  arrives bout 10min after leaving alicante city
